Signs Of A Broken Pipe
Unusual water bills, damp spots, or low water pressure may indicate pipe damage.
Common Causes Of Pipe Breaks
Freezing temperatures, aging pipes, and ground shifting can lead to pipe failures in columbus homes.
Benefits Of Prompt Replacement
Replacing damaged pipes helps prevent water damage, mold growth, and costly repairs.

Broken Pipe Replacement Questions
What causes pipes to break? Pipes can break due to age, freezing temperatures, shifting soil, or corrosion over time.
How can I tell if a pipe is broken? Signs include water leaks, low water pressure, or unexplained water bills.
What types of pipes are typically replaced? Commonly replaced pipes include copper, PVC, and galvanized steel pipes.
Why is timely replacement important? Prompt replacement helps prevent water damage and further plumbing issues in the property.
